Thomas Hobbes is the social philosopher that believed the best government to ensure a social contract was an absolute government.

Step-by-step explanation:

Thomas Hobbes is the greatest representative of political absolutism. He wrote the Leviatan, a work in which he defends the absolute power of kings and proposed that nations prosper under a monarchy, not because they have a prince, but because they obey him.

He considers that the State is a contract made by humans through which they accept that certain freedoms are limited in exchange of laws. As a political theory it has been transformed over time but it is possibly the one that has permeated the current configuration of the States and Nations.
